烤烟成熟期生态因子与色素及淀粉的关系 被引量:1

Relationship between Ecological Factors,Pigment and Starch in Flue-cured Tobacco during Maturity

摘要 为了解烤烟成熟期生态因子与色素及淀粉的变化规律,探究了烤烟成熟期生态因子与色素及淀粉的关系。对烤烟中部叶成熟期生长过程中的气温、光照及降水等生态因子变化进行了监测,并对成熟期烟叶色素及淀粉含量进行测定,运用简单相关分析及典型相关分析法,研究了烤烟成熟期生态因子对色素及淀粉含量的综合影响。结果表明:烤烟在整个成熟期的平均温度为25.29℃,生理成熟阶段和工艺成熟阶段平均温度高于欠熟阶段和近熟阶段,平均日照时数为14.11 h,其中欠熟阶段平均日照时数较短,而生理成熟阶段和近熟阶段平均日照时数较长,主要降水集中在生理成熟阶段。相关分析结果表明:成熟期生态因子的变化与烟叶内色素含量及淀粉含量变化相关性较强;典型相关分析结果表明:一定范围内成熟期光照时数越长烟叶的叶绿素含量越多,相对湿度越大淀粉含量越高。 In order to understand the changes of ecological factors,pigments and starch in the mature period of flue-cured tobacco,the relationship between ecological factors,pigment and starch in the maturity of flue-cured tobacco was explored.The changes of ecological factors such as temperature,light and precipitation during the growth of middle leaves of flue-cured tobacco were monitored,and the pigment and starch content of tobacco leaves at maturity were measured.The comprehensive effects of the ecological factors on the pigment and starch content in the mature period of flue-cured tobacco were studied by simple correlation analysis and typical correlation analysis.The results showed that the average temperature of flue-cured tobacco in the whole maturity period was 25.29℃.The average temperature in the physiological ripening stage and the mature stage of the process was higher than that in the under-mature stage and the near-mature stage,and the average sunshine hours were 14.11 h.The average sunshine hours in the under-maturing stage was shorter,while the average sunshine hours in the physiological ripening stage and the near-maturing stage were longer,and the main precipitation was concentrated in the physiological maturity stage.Correlation analysis showed that the changes of ecological factors in the mature period were strongly correlated with the changes of pigment content and starch content in tobacco leaves.The results of typical correlation analysis showed that the longer the light hours in the mature period,the more chlorophyll content of the tobacco leaves,and the higher the relative humidity,the higher the starch content.
